A Chinese lacquered and gilt bronze figure of Shoulao Ming dynasty

明 銅鎏金彩漆壽老坐像

£2,000 - £3,000 £2,000

A Chinese lacquered and gilt bronze figure of Shoulao Ming dynasty, sitting in a formal pose on the back of a deer, the hexagonal plinth with two leaf-shaped apertures, an inscription to the reverse which reads kai huang shi liu nian er yue shi wu, Wang Jia Yao da fu jing zao fo yi qu jia, which translates as 'made in the 16th year, kai huang, on the 15th February, by Yang Jia Yao' corresponding to 596 AD, 35.5cm.

明  銅鎏金彩漆壽老坐像

銘文:開皇十六年二月十五王賈夭大夫敬造佛一區佳
